Girraween High School
Girraween High School (784 students) is a fully academically selective, co-educational high school located in Western Sydney. Generally, 100% of Year 12 graduates will undertake tertiary study at University. Student wellbeing and academic excellence are fostered through programs including student mentoring and our RAW (Resilience, Achievement and Wellbeing) Model of Positive Education.
